On the Table: ‘Zombicide: Black Plague’ Board Game Review
The fourth standalone board game in CoolMiniOrNot and Guillotine Games’ hit zombie killin’ franchise is finally here! This time, things get more than a little medieval in what may very well be the best ‘Zombicide’ adventure yet.

I’ve heard good things about ‘Zombicide’ for a few years now, but since I had already owned a couple of other zombie-themed board games, I didn’t really feel the need to add one more to my collection. But when I saw the ‘Zombicide: Black Plague’ Kickstarter campaign launch last summer, I just couldn’t stop myself from jumping in and making a pledge. I’m glad I did because this is a fun and tension filled game that really captures the essence of a zombipocalypse.

We live in the golden age of games, there are amazing card games, and board games that are better than anything that was around in the 70's. Yet these people who have game nights weekly don't seem to know about anything that was invented in the last 40 years. Pictionary, and charades are go-to games for them. Please don't get me wrong, I quite enjoy playing those games to. But it would be as if there was a movie about Art appreciators , and everyone in the film had only seen art that was painted before the 1900's, just completely omitting anything modern is absurd.

It would've taken almost no effort to include a few modern board games, like Ticket to Ride, 7 Wonders, Sushi Go, or Settlers of Catan.

   All that said, I finally watched this film and enjoyed it for the most part. Rachel McAdams was awesome, and stole the show.... Batemen was himself and solid. The cop almost derailed the movie for me he was so creepy.
